Abstract

We present the flight configuration and performance of the superconducting integrated receiver (SIR) channel on the TELIS instrument (terahertz and submm limb sounder). The SIR is an on-chip combination of a low-noise SIS mixer with a quasioptical antenna, a superconducting flux flow oscillator (FFO) acting as local oscillator (LO) and an SIS harmonic mixer (HM) for FFO phase locking. The SIR has been assembled, fully integrated into the system and is currently being thoroughly tested in preparation for the flight campaign in October 2007 (Teresina, Brazil).
